Summer storms in the area can bring heavy rain, causing water damage to your property. The monsoon season, which usually runs from June to September, can lead to flash flooding and overflowing rivers, making it crucial to be prepared for clean water extraction services in Tolleson, AZ. Clean Water Extraction (Category 1) v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ak (less than 10 gallons) Yes No You can likely handle a small water leak on your own with a wet vacuum and some basic tools.
Moderate water leak (10-100 gallons) No Yes A moderate water leak needs specialized equipment and expertise to extract the water and prevent further damage.
Large water leak (over 100 gallons) No Yes A large water leak needs immediate attention and specialized equipment to extract the water and prevent further damage.
Water damage in a sensitive area (e.g. Electrical room) No Yes Water damage in sensitive areas needs specialized expertise and equipment to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
Water damage in a large area (e.g. Entire house) No Yes Water damage in a large area needs specialized equipment and expertise to extract the water and prevent further damage.

How Do I Prevent Water Damage?

Preventing water damage in Tolleson, AZ needs regular maintenance and inspections. Check your pipes and appliances regularly for leaks, and ensure that your roof and foundation are in good condition. Stay proactive to prevent water damage.

What Happens if I Ignore Water Damage?

Ignoring water damage in Tolleson, AZ can lead to costly repairs, health hazards, and structural damage. Water damage can also lead to mold and mildew growth, which can be a serious health hazard. Don’t ignore water damage – address it immediately.
